  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the arng 1058 1r in the editor.
  2. Begin by filling in the Title and Program for the tour at the top of the form. Specify whether it is under Title 10 USC/ADSW or Title 32 USC/FTNGD.
  3. Indicate if the soldier has achieved or will achieve 17 years of Active Federal Service (AFS) prior to or during this tour by selecting 'Yes' or 'No'.
  4. Next, answer whether the soldier has achieved or will achieve 18 years of AFS, again selecting 'Yes' or 'No'.
  5. Fill in the number of days proposed for this tour in the designated field.
  6. Answer if the soldier has performed any other AD or FTNGD within this fiscal year, and if so, specify how many total days.
  7. Determine if TAG has approval authority based on cumulative service days this fiscal year and select 'Yes' or 'No'.
  8. Continue through each question regarding service duration, approvals needed, and signature requirements as outlined in the checklist.
